It is very complicated to choose the most beautiful one and, therefore, there is an Association in Italy that ‘does the hard work’ for us: it’s Borghi Più Belli dell’Italia (“Most Beautiful Villages in Italy”). They are responsible for visiting, getting to know and including – or not – the most beautiful villages in Italy on their exclusive list. They analyze several cities, in different regions and, later, divulge the result that is always very expected, but never surprises us, because the locations are, in fact, fantastic. 1) The most beautiful villages in Tuscany: ANGHIARI

Anghiari is a charming village located in Valtiberina, in the province of Arezzo. The time there seems to have stopped and the place is of a surreal beauty! Surrounded by walls from the 13th century, it has a medieval center of great charm and became very famous for the Battle of 1440.

11) The most beautiful villages in Tuscany: LUCIGNANO

The name Lucignano derives from a Roman fort founded by consul Licínio; there, the numerous archaeological finds suggest that the city, at the time of the Etruscans, was densely populated and, to this day, the city tells us delightful stories about everything that has already happened there.

14) The most beautiful villages in Tuscany: MONTEMERANO

This small medieval town – built on Etruscan lands – is in the heart of Maremma and preserves all the tradition of its most distant times. Its historic center is surrounded by three walls, at the top of a garden inhabited by olive and cypress trees. When we find ourselves facing a panorama that extends from Mount Amiata to Argentario, and from the Albegna valley to the Tyrrhenian Sea, admiring a sunset from here is almost mandatory.

16) The most beautiful villages in Tuscany: PITIGLIANO

One of the most famous villages in Tuscany is also one of the most beautiful. Little Tuscan Jerusalem is shown in a simple, discreet, rustic and very beautiful way! Here, over the centuries, men preferred to dig rather than build, and thanks to the ease of working with volcanic rock, a “tuff civilization” was born, which left its mark on this very special land.

17) The most beautiful villages in Tuscany: POPPI

Poppi is in Tuscany (you can read “Pupium agri Clusentini caput” in Vasari’s fresco, in the Vecchio Palace, in Florence), but it is a different Tuscany: it is a Tuscany from Casentino, land of Romanesque castles and churches, from Dante’s favorite places and the terracotta of Della Robbia, where the mark of the Middle Ages is even stronger. It impresses by beauty, culture, history and magic; this village is practically a poem for our senses.

22) The most beautiful villages in Tuscany: SANTA FIORA

Santa Fiora was the capital of the former County of the area. It was under the domain of the Aldobrandeschi family and then the power of the Sforza and Sforza Cesarini families. It was an autonomous state from the 9th century to the 17th century; after that period it was offered to the Grand Dukes of Tuscany, but remained autonomous until the reforms of Pietro Leopoldo (in the late 1700s).
